Trend 1: “Solar + Storage” Takes Absolute Center Stage
If past expos were all about competing on monocrystalline module wattage or racing to the bottom on distributed solar pricing, Manila 2026 was indisputably dominated by “Storage.” From Utility-Scale Battery Energy Storage Systems (BESS) and Commercial & Industrial (C&I) setups to residential solutions, almost every top-tier exhibitor positioned integrated “Solar + Storage” as their flagship offering.

Behind the Booming Manila Expo 2

The Catalyst: The Mandate Requiring 20% Storage for Projects Over 10MW
On the show floor, a client mentioned, “The crowd is massive this year because the government just announced energy storage subsidies.” While this comment gets to the heart of the excitement, the actual mechanism is far more powerful than a simple cash subsidy. Just ahead of the expo in March 2026, the Philippine Department of Energy (DOE) officially issued Department Circular No. DC2026-02-0008. This milestone regulation mandates that all newly applied renewable energy power plants with a capacity of 10 megawatts (MW) or above must integrate an Energy Storage System (ESS) equivalent to at least 20% of the plant’s total capacity.

As an archipelago, the Philippines struggles with a highly fragmented grid and notoriously weak infrastructure; frequent brownouts and voltage instability have long been a thorn in the side of local development. This hardline mandate from the government instantly elevated storage from an “optional luxury” to a “grid-connection necessity,” triggering an overnight surge in procurement demand among large project developers and EPCs. Trend 2: The Dominance of Chinese Supply Chains and the Shift to “Hyper-Localization”
Looking across the exhibition halls, Tier-1 Chinese module giants, inverter manufacturers, and ESS integrators occupied the largest and most prominent booths. However, the more significant shift was operational: Chinese exhibitors are no longer just sending overseas sales reps to “test the waters.” Instead, they are arriving with fully built-out, highly proficient local technical and sales teams.

Behind the Booming Manila Expo 3

The Catalyst: 100% Foreign Ownership and a “Zero-Tariff” Incentive Package
The Philippines has long had some of the highest electricity rates in the world. To accelerate its decarbonization targets, the government previously amended its laws to allow 100% foreign ownership of renewable energy projects. Building on that, they rolled out a highly lucrative fiscal package for 2026:

Zero Import Tariffs: Lithium iron phosphate (LFP) batteries, inverters, and core ESS equipment manufactured in China now enter the Philippines duty-free.

Tax Holidays & Exemptions: Eligible renewable energy and storage projects enjoy substantial Income Tax Holidays (ITH) and Value-Added Tax (VAT) exemptions.

This combination of policies has unlocked a massive wave of opportunity for Chinese solar and storage players. To win high-barrier local C&I projects—such as massive rooftop rollouts for commercial giants like the SM Group—and to partner with utility titans like Meralco, Chinese suppliers are aggressively localizing their technical support and after-sales services. The market dynamics have officially evolved from a price war to a localized service war. Trend 3: Buyers Shift from “Inquisitive” to “Project-Ready”
This year didn’t just break records for visitor volume; it saw a quantum leap in buyer intent. The casual foot traffic of “brochure collectors” was replaced by highly focused buyers arriving with actual project blueprints, rooftop dimensions, and utility bills in hand, looking for immediate hardware sourcing and partnerships. The business matchings were exceptionally pragmatic and efficient.

The Catalyst: The Emergency State and the Reality of Sky-High Power Bills
In late March of this year, triggered by global oil and gas supply shocks, Philippine President Marcos signed Executive Order No. 110, declaring a National Energy Emergency. Despite the government injecting tens of billions of pesos in emergency funds to stabilize tariffs, commercial and residential electricity bills have continued to climb.

Behind the Booming Manila Expo 5

Faced with these punishing grid costs, C&I owners and residential users now have an undeniable financial incentive to deploy independent “Solar + Storage” microgrids for self-consumption. For these buyers, escaping the burden of high utility rates is, in itself, the most immediate and tangible “subsidy.”

Post-Expo Reflections
For a long time, the consensus on the Philippines was that it was a market with “immense potential but slow execution.” However, Solar & Storage Live Philippines 2026 has sent an unmistakable signal: driven by the convergence of high electricity costs, an energy crisis, rigid storage mandates, and an open foreign investment policy, the Philippine solar-plus-storage market has reached its “tipping point.”
